Kinnerton is far from your typical brand. Pioneering the introduction of character chocolate in the UK in 1978 under the Kinnerton Kids label, we have consistently evolved, securing our position as one of the UK's leading manufacturers of seasonal goods. Each year, we proudly craft millions of delightful advent calendars and Easter eggs, highlighting our commitment to excellence.
What sets us apart is our distinct offering to customers, characterised by our nut-safe promise and unwavering dedication to product innovation. As the inventive minds behind NOMO chocolate, an award-winning and delicious free-from range, we continue to redefine the chocolate experience.
